A male celebrity was active by the time of the High Republic Era. At some point, he began using the mycopram regenerative substance to look younger. When the celebrity boasted about how he looked—with some individuals thinking he looked twelve years old—the price of mycopram surged. At some point afterward,[1] in 229 BBY,[2] the black market smuggler Argomon delivered eighteen boxes of the regenerative substance to Nihil scientist Niv Drendow Apruk on the prison ship Korvix Vorn. When Apruk questioned why the smuggler had brought such a small amount, Argomon recounted that the celebrity's usage of the substance had caused a price and demand surge.[1]

Behind the scenes

The celebrity was mentioned in the third issue of the 2023 comic series Star Wars: The High Republic Adventures. The issue was written by Daniel José Older and published by Dark Horse Comics as part of the Star Wars: The High Republic multimedia project's[1] Phase III on February 14, 2024.[3]
